Description

A substantial, well-presented home benefitting from a convenient location close to Broadway High Street

Beautifully reconfigured, 5 Mills Close offers practical, light-filled accommodation perfectly suited to modern family life and entertaining. The welcoming entrance hall provides access to all principal rooms, including the integral garage. At the heart of the home is the recently renovated kitchen, thoughtfully redesigned to create an impressive open-plan space with quartz worktops, a breakfast bar, shaker-style cabinetry, a dedicated dining area and a useful utility room. French doors open directly onto the attractive west-facing garden, creating an effortless connection between indoor and outdoor living.
The elegant sitting room features a striking stone fireplace with a thermostatically controlled flame-effect electric fire, providing a cosy focal point during the winter months. Double doors lead through to the conservatory, which in turn opens onto the garden. A generous study and a separate cloakroom complete the ground floor.
The first-floor centres around an impressive galleried landing with an airing cupboard and additional storage. The principal bedroom enjoys a spacious dressing room with fitted wardrobes and an en-suite bathroom featuring a bath, separate shower, WC and wash basin. The second bedroom also benefits from fitted double wardrobes and its own en-suite shower room, while two further bedrooms overlook the rear garden and are served by the well-appointed family bathroom.

OUTSIDE
The attractive front gardens sit alongside a driveway providing off-road parking for two vehicles and leading to a double garage with up-and-over doors. Side access is available on both sides of the property, leading to the beautifully maintained rear garden. Designed for both relaxation and entertaining, the garden features a lawn, patio, arbour, garden shed, and well-stocked flowerbeds. It is partially enclosed by a wall, offering a good degree of privacy, with convenient access to the property from both sides. A public footpath provides a short walk to the High Street.

Broadway is well known as one of the most lovely of the Cotswold centres, yet it also has the advantage of excellent facilities including a supermarket, chemist, post office, butcher, delicatessen, dentist, optician, vets, churches, library and medical centre. In addition there is an extensive range of cafes, restaurants, galleries and shops, as well as health and leisure facilities in the village and surrounding areas. The larger cultural and shopping centres for the area are Cheltenham (16.7 miles) and Stratford-uponAvon (14.7 miles). There is a mainline train station to London/Paddington at Honeybourne (5.4 miles), Evesham (6.2 miles) and Moreton-in-Marsh (9.5 miles) scheduled time approximately 90 minutes.
